>+#define ENET_MAXF_SIZE 1536 >+#define ENET_RX_DESC 48 >+#define ENET_TX_DESC 16 >+ >+/* >+ * FIXME >+ * Dynamic buffer allocation as needed >+ * Check/fix ethtool support >+ * Better MAC address support >+ * Better DMA allocation support (dma pool) >+ */
Although the packet buffers are handled correctly, the number of MAC DMA descriptors are hard coded to the ENET_RX_DESC and ENET_TX_DESC size values. There is also a 'funky' scheme for doing virt<>phy address translation for the descriptors.
I'm ok with releasing this driver "as is" with its current quirks, but I do think these fixmes need to be fixed at some time.
